Job info
Registered Nurse - Ambulatory
Location: Cambridge, Massachusetts
Shift: 9-hour Day Shift (08:00 - 19:00), Monday - Friday
Hours per Week: 36
Contract Length: 12 weeks
Job Description
- Work unit: Ambulatory care at East Cambridge Health Center
- Must work every other major holiday
- Scrub color: Any
Required Qualifications
- Minimum 1 year of experience in specialty (Ambulatory Nursing)
- Acute care experience required
- Prior travel experience required; first-time travelers will not be considered
- Two recent references from Charge RN, Manager, or Supervisor in the same specialty
- Current, active or conditional Massachusetts RN license verified via NURSYS report (including all past and present licenses)
- Current AHA BLS certification
- Flu vaccine required during flu season
- Valid driver’s license with address matching candidate demographics
- Skills checklist matching specialty required
- Return to Office (RTO) date must be included at time of submission
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ience with EPIC electronic medical records system
Additional Notes
- Local candidates within 50 miles are accepted
- Shift coverage includes every other major holiday
About Cambridge, MA
As a Travel Ambulatory Care Nurse in Cambridge, MA here's what you should know:Cost of Living
- The cost of living in Cambridge is higher than the national average, with housing costs being the most significant factor.
- Wages may be higher to match the cost of living.
Weather
- Summer average highs: 80°F, average lows: 60°F.
- Winter average highs: 40°F, average lows: 20°F.
Furnished Housing
- Short term rentals can be found in Cambridge, but they may be more expensive due to the high demand from students and professionals.
Transportation
- Cambridge is public transportation friendly with access to buses and subways.
- It is also bike-friendly, but parking can be challenging.
Demographics
- Cambridge is diverse with a mix of students, professionals, and families.
- Common health issues may include stress-related conditions due to the academic and professional environment.
- There is a large population of travel nurses due to the presence of prestigious medical and educational institutions.
Things to Do
- Cambridge offers a vibrant food scene with diverse restaurants, a rich art and music culture, and plenty of outdoor activities along the Charles River.
- There are also numerous museums and historic sites to explore.
